    In the paid version, the drive-by protection mode (under webguard settings) keeps the malicious I-frames at bay from your computer.

    I'm not sure about the free Personal version though. Please anyone confirm.
     
  4. Arup

    Arup Guest

    The free Avira doesn't have webguard which is needed to provide i-frame protection.

    Avira Free works well with avast! Home (without Standard Shield)...

    Just exclude the files:
    Code:
    
    C:\Windows\Temp\_avast4_\unp*.tmp
    C:\Documents and Settings\xpto\Local Settings\Temp\_avast4_\unp*.tmp
    I don't know why excluding "*\_avast4_\unp*.tmp" doesn't work in Avira...
